Portsmouth Police were once again called in to search for a child who took off from a local group home. The facility also advised that they had a different child threatening other kids at the facility.
Police caught up with the missing child on Waller Street and headed to the group home.
At the facility, the boy said he tried to look through a bathroom window after he saw steam coming from it and that another child threatened to beat him up over the incident. He said he wasn’t running away; he was just trying to get away from the conflict.
Officers contacted CPS, and workers said the children should be separated. One of the kids was transported to another group home in the area.
